"UK firms to develop Na-ion batteries"


"Faradion of Sheffield and Caithness battery make AGM Batteries have agreed to commercialise sodium-ion batteries. Sodium is proposed as a cheaper alternative to relatively-rare lithium in rechargeable cells. "it is expected that sodium-ion batteries will also cost around 30% less to produce compared to conventional lithium ion technologies," said Faradion, which has sodium ion intellectual property."
